Abstract
The utility model discloses a kind of radio transmitting devices convenient for adjusting, including mounting plate, annular groove is offered at the top of the mounting plate, motor is fixedly connected at the top of the mounting plate, the middle part on the mounting plate top is connected with fixing sleeve by bearing, the internal activity of the annular groove is connected with movable block, and bracket is fixedly connected at the top of the movable block, and the top of the bracket is fixedly connected with hydraulic cylinder.This is convenient for the radio transmitting device adjusted, drive bevel gear rotation is driven by motor, so that motion bar drives support plate rotation, support plate is driven to carry out height adjustment using hydraulic cylinder simultaneously, so that the height of emitter is constantly adjusted, guide pad is driven to be slided in the inside of guide groove using electric pushrod, so that connecting plate angle change, so as to carry out comprehensive adjusting to emitter, broadcast transmission effect can be effectively improved.
